Abstract

This paper discusses a detailed approach to the optimization of laser-fired contacts for the rear surface-passivated p-type crystalline silicon solar cell. To obtain a proper ohmic contact, there are various parameters which should be taken into account while making LFCs, such as pitch, pulse length (or duty cycle ratio), laser output power and number of pulses. Optimization methodology for forming an ohmic laser-fired contact and the respective parametric values for the pulse modulated CW laser are reported.
